ZOOMING IN ON A SUBJECT (OPTICAL
ZOOM)
Telephoto and wide-angle shooting are possible at 3× magnification (the
optical zoom limit, equivalent to 38 mm - 114 mm on a 35 mm camera). By
combining the optical zoom with the digital zoom, zoom magnification can be
increased to a maximum of approximately 10×.
1
Slide the power switch to
lock button.
• The camera turns on in the shooting mode.
• The lens extends and the monitor turns on.
2
Push/pull the zoom lever while observing the subject on

the monitor.

3
Take the picture.
• Pictures taken with the digital zoom may appear grainy.
